What's Happening?
Offset, the former Migos rapper, was shot near the Seminole Hard Rock Hotel & Casino in Hollywood, Florida. According to a representative for Offset, the incident occurred on Monday evening at a valet area outside the casino. Offset sustained non-life-threatening
injuries and was transported to Memorial Regional Hospital in Hollywood, where he is reported to be stable and under medical care. The Seminole Police were on site immediately following the incident, and the situation was quickly contained. Two individuals have been detained in connection with the shooting, and the investigation is ongoing. The casino remains operational, and there is no threat to the public.
